Pioneering Spirit
The world’s largest and most versatile construction vessel, represents a step change in offshore engineering. Purpose-built to transport, install and remove entire offshore platforms in a single lift, our record-breaking vessel is also capable of installing ultra-heavy pipelines across any water depth.
Transforming platform installation and decommissioning
Engineered entirely in-house, Pioneering Spirit has transformed offshore operations. Its groundbreaking single-lift technology enables the installation or removal of platform topsides up to 60,000 tonnes and jackets up to 20,000 tonnes, reducing offshore exposure and transferring complex activities onshore where they are safer and more cost-effective. This streamlined process minimises risk, costs and development timelines, setting new standards for operational efficiency.
Unmatched pipelay capacity
The world’s largest and most advanced pipelay vessel, Pioneering Spirit, sets the benchmark in offshore pipeline installation. With an unmatched S-lay tension capacity of 2000 tonnes, she installs pipelines of record weight from shallow to ultra-deep waters with precision positioning enabled by 12 azimuth thrusters. A double-joint factory, six welding stations, and extensive pipe storage allow continuous, high-speed pipelay, delivering superior installation performance for critical offshore energy infrastructure projects.
More about Sif:
Sif is located in the Port of Rotterdam’s Maasvlakte and is a leading factory producing giant steel foundations, monopiles and transition pieces for offshore wind turbines. Here, the whole process takes place from steel to a finalized coated tube; everything is XXXL. With direct deep-sea access at the doorstep of the North Sea, this facility makes Sif a key player in Europe’s renewable energy future, turning steel and innovation into the backbone of offshore wind.
